From Migration to Resilience - Moussa Hassan’s Story
For years, Moussa Hassan left his home in Niger in search of work in Kano, Nigeria. With few job opportunities available locally, he spent long periods away from his family and even missed the birth of his first child while working abroad.
Today, Moussa’s life has changed.
Through land restoration activities supported by the United Nations World Food Programme (WFP), Moussa learned techniques to restore degraded land and improve food production in his community.
He now grows rice, which he sells at the local market. Moussa has also been able to buy cattle and generate additional income by selling milk. Most importantly, he can now stay at home with his family.
By restoring the land, Moussa has restored his livelihood, and his future.
